Former World Cup winner reflects on Street Soccer journey | James’ Story

It’s been twelve years since that day in Paris and for former Team Scotland player James Horsburgh, the feeling of immense pride has never changed. Street Soccer session to stay in Stenhousemuir

In partnership with Stenhousemuir Football Club’s Warriors in the Community, Street Soccer will add its session at Ochilview Stadium to its growing list of permanent sessions as part of its network programme.
